Overall Satisfaction with Figma
Figma was introduced into our organization after InVision announced it was ending. Prior to Figma, our designers were using InVision, Adobe XD, and Sketch. I personally despised using Sketch for UX/UI projects and design systems work. It was such a pain using Sketch because I felt like the interface was clunky and not intuitive. Figma is far superior. Both Figma, and Figma Jam will be used to help our teams collaborate and work on visual, brand, and UX/UI projects.

Cons
- Honoring clipping masks when playing the prototype. It's super annoying because Figma acts as if there isn't a clipping mask and adds extra padding to my screen designs when presenting.
